If eterm is not the right status, then please file the bug report
against that package, with the exact version you used.

On my system, apt-cache does not show the reconmends line on eterm,
so I think this was fixed already, and close this report.
If you check the updated version of eterm and find another problem
with it, then please file the bug on that package, not the base.

"base" consists of the standard Debian packages, but it has
some amount of time lag with the current archive, because base tarball
 (base2_2.tgz) is made of the packages which are gotten from our ftp 
archive at it's build time.

So the problem with the base can be traced to the correct package
which has or had the bug, sometimes the package is fixed before tester
use the base in boot-floppies. This time lag will be eventually resolved
at the release or the testing time, when the packages are not updated anymore.
